Forest products are economically valued : wood is used as fuel for fires used in homes. Industrial harvesting has allowed for extracting more timber in recent times than before. Ways to harvest timber: clear cutting : In this method all trees are cleared on the area leaving only stumps. Most cost efficient method on short term: seed tree and shelterwood approach, selection harvest. Afforestation planting of trees where forest led cover has not existed for some time. Deforestation loss of forested area worldwide. It adds to carbon dioxide to the atmosphere. Carbon dioxide is released when plant matter is burned or decomposed and less vegetation remains to soak up co2. Sustainable forest management is management of renewable natural resources is based on maintaining equilibrium between stocks and flows.
